Lecture Quiz 2.0 was the first prototype where both teacher and student clients had web-interfaces. An experiment testing the 2.0 prototype showed that the usability had been improved both for the teacher and the student clients, and that the concept increased students' motivation, engagement, concentration, and perceived learning. After preparation by the teacher, students become responsible for their own learning and teaching. The new material is divided into small units and student groups of not more than three people are formed. [5] Students are then encouraged to experiment to find ways to teach the material to the others.

A massively multiplayer online role-playing game (MMORPG) is a video game that combines aspects of a role-playing video game and a massively multiplayer online game.. As in role-playing games (RPGs), the player assumes the role of a character (often in a fantasy world or science-fiction world) and takes control over many of that character's actions.

Blindfold chess was first played quite early on in the history of chess.The earliest name to be associated with play without the use of a material board is that of Sa'id bin Jubair (665–714) in the Middle East.
The Central Teacher Eligibility Test (CTET) was established when, in accordance with the provisions of sub-section (1) of Section 23 of the RTE Act, the National Council for Teacher Education (NCTE) received notifications dated 23 August 2010 and 29 July 2011 stipulating minimum qualifications for eligibility to teach Classes I to VIII.
